Both technology-driven advancements in medical transcription and medical coding have transformed the healthcare industry. Here are some comparisons between the two:

  1. Automation and Efficiency:
    • Medical Transcription: Technology has automated various aspects of medical transcription, such as speech recognition software that converts voice recordings into text. This has increased efficiency and reduced the time required for transcribing medical reports.
    • Medical Coding: Similar to medical transcription, technology has automated several processes in medical coding. Advanced coding software can analyze medical documentation and assign appropriate codes, streamlining the coding process and reducing human error.
  2. Accuracy and Quality:
    • Medical Transcription: Technology has significantly improved the accuracy and quality of medical transcription. Speech recognition software, coupled with advanced algorithms, ensures better transcription accuracy and consistency in the generated reports.
    • Medical Coding: With the help of coding software, medical coders can access up-to-date coding guidelines and databases, minimizing coding errors and improving accuracy. Automated coding checks also help in identifying coding inconsistencies and reducing claim denials.
  3. Human Intervention:
    • Medical Transcription: Despite technology’s advancements, medical transcription often requires some level of human intervention. Transcriptionists review and edit the transcribed reports, ensuring accuracy and maintaining the integrity of the patient’s medical information.
    • Medical Coding: While technology has automated many coding processes, it still requires skilled medical coders to interpret clinical documentation accurately. Human intervention is crucial in complex cases where coding guidelines need careful consideration and judgment.
  4. Adaptability to New Technologies:
    • Medical Transcription: Advances in natural language processing (NLP) and machine learning techniques have improved the automation of medical transcription. These technologies enable transcription software to learn and adapt to different medical specialties, accents, and dialects, enhancing accuracy.
    • Medical Coding: Technology has also evolved in medical coding, leveraging NLP and machine learning algorithms. This enables coding software to recognize and extract relevant information from clinical documentation, improving coding efficiency and accuracy.
  5. Potential Impact on Jobs:
    • Medical Transcription: Automation in medical transcription has affected the job market for traditional medical transcriptionists. However, new opportunities have emerged in editing and quality control roles, requiring a different skill set.
    • Medical Coding: While technology has automated certain coding processes, skilled medical coders are still in demand. The complexities of medical coding, the need for accurate interpretation, and the evolving healthcare landscape ensure a continued requirement for human expertise.

In summary, both medical transcription and medical coding have experienced significant advancements due to technology. Automation has increased efficiency, improved accuracy, and streamlined processes in both domains. However, while technology has greatly influenced the industry, it has not completely replaced human involvement, as certain aspects still require skilled professionals to ensure accuracy and maintain quality.
